Vaisala WINDCAP Ultrasonic Wind Sensor WS425
Measures wind speed and direction from the smallest breeze to hurricane force gales (0...65 m/s), including gusts
Superior data availability and accuracy in all wind directions due to the patented three transducer layout
Averaging of wind speed and direction
Analog, RS-232, RS-422, RS-485 and SDI-12 outputs
Low power consumption
No moving parts: virtually maintenance free
Stainless steel construction
Heated model available
US National Weather Service relies on Vaisala ultrasonic technology
The Vaisala Ultrasonic Wind Sensor WS425 gives meteorologists an alternative to the cup and vane mechanical sensors. With its continuous data availability, the WS425 is also ideal for a variety of wind measurement applications in aviation, road and railway safety and energy production.
Accurate and maintenancefree
The WS425 has no moving parts, and is resistant to contamination and corrosion. In addition to improving accuracy and the reliability of data in all wind conditions and climates, the WS425 eliminates on-demand and periodic maintenance.
Outputs
SDI-12 provides the most extensive set of commands and calculations. The standard RS-232/485/422 protocol supports NMEA and three other message formats. Analog outputs are available as an option.
Technical Data
Wind speed
Measurement range
serial output 0...65 m/s (0...144 mph, 0...125 knots)
analog output 0...56 m/s (0...124 mph, 0...107 knots)
Starting threshold virtually zero
Delay distance virtually zero
Resolution 0.1 m/s (0.1 mph, 0.1 knots, 0.1 km/h)
Accuracy (range 0...65 m/s) +/- 0.135 m/s (+/-0.3 mph, +/-0.26 knots)
or 3% of reading, whichever is greater
Wind direction
Measurement range 0...360deg
Starting threshold virtually zero
Delay distance virtually zero
Resolution 1deg
Accuracy (wind speed over 1 m/s) +/-2deg
Outputs
Digital outputs type RS232, RS422 or RS485, four different message formats
bit rate adjustable from 1200 to 19200 bit/s available averages RS232: 1 to 9 seconds
SDI-12 Standard Data Interface type 3 wires for ground, signal and supply bit rate fixed 1200 bit/s available averages 1 to 3600 seconds
Analog outputs
wind speed
frequency 5 Hz/mph
voltage 8.0 mV/mph
output impedance 10 kohm
wind direction
simulated potentiometer 0...Vrefrepresents 0...359deg
reference voltage 1.0...4.0 V
output impedance 24 kohm
General
Operating power supply 10...15 VDC, 12 mA typical (analog)
and for heated model 36 VDC +/-10 %, 0.7 A
Operating temperature
WS425 non-heated –40...+55C (-40...+131F)
WS425 heated –55...+55C (-67...+131F)
Material
body stainless steel (AISI 316)
sensor arms stainless steel (AISI 316)
transducer heads silicone rubber
Dimensions
height 355 mm (14")
width 250 mm (10")
depth 286 mm (12")
Weight 1.7 kg (3.7 lbs)
